Single-storey rear extension planning approval rate in Greenwich

96% of 54 decided single-storey rear extension applications in Greenwich were approved.

How to read these rates

These are historical outcomes for the applications in our archive, not the chance of approval for your property. Compare the same project type and read the decided count alongside each percentage.

About the planning data

Rate = approved divided by approved plus refused, using the decisions in our classified archive. Rates are withheld as unknown where fewer than 8 records of that project type were decided. Withdrawn applications are excluded.

Recent means records dated 2022 or later. Records without a year are excluded from the recent rate but remain in the all-years figure. Historical coverage varies by council, and duplicate application references may remain in the archive.
